When temperature of an ideal gas is increased from 27°C to 227°C, its rms speed is changed from 400 m/s to vs Then, vs is

  • 516 m/s

  • 450 m/s

  • 310 m/s

  • 746 m/s

Solution

A.

516 m/s

We know that the rms speed is directly proportional to square root of temperature.
